Editors, proofreaders, 
web designers, 
web developers and bloggers have been waiting for this. Tiporgaf was supposed to be updated back 
in January , 
but is being updated only today. So glad to introduce you 
Typograph 2.0 !
Over the past year, 
I have repeatedly rethought my vision of typography 
in general and of my typographer 
in particular . I collected a lot of material, 
and despite the fact that right now I am announcing the second version, I am already working on the 
3rd version.
I congratulate 
all of us, the main browsers have 
finally begun to support the characters:, & thinsp, & ensp, & emsp (the exception is Opera, 
but I will work 
on this). 
In this regard, we will get used to impose the web 
in a new way , using the correct white space characters 
and floating hyphenation.
Now I suggest to get acquainted 
with the list of changes:
')
NEW- Now, more / less characters are replaced with mnemonics , while the tags are not touched .
- A rule has been added that catches some combinations of words with inches (for example, a 17 ″ monitor).
- Added rule typing minutes and seconds 123′12 ″.
- Added rule for hyphenation in complex prepositions: due , out of .
- Now, before typing, all soft transfers made by third-party algorithms are removed.
- Added the ability to set soft hyphenation.
- Added acronyms SEO, SMO, CMS, WYSIWYG, WYSIWYM.
- Added the ability to correctly typography lists copied from Word .
- Added & thinsp to all necessary rules, and <nobr> removed from these rules (6 items in total).
- Added rule processing point in .htaccess, .htpasswd
- A rule has been added that frames fragments in inseparable constructions, written by fractions ( railway , a / i, ...).
- The typographer now supports Habrahabr. When preparing articles for posting on Habr, you can use <habracut ... /> or HABR (more ...).
CHANGES- Rewritten the algorithm of the engine, increased speed, reduced memory costs.
- The algorithm for the placement of acronyms was rewritten (PrĂŞt-Ă -Porter was typed incorrectly).
- Changed some defaults in settings . Now, by default, the use of non-breaking constructions instead of non-breaking spaces is enabled and trapping of suspended words is disabled .
- Rewritten uninterrupted combining module.
SETTINGS- A button “Reset” has been added to the settings , which resets them to their default values.
- A setting has been made that allows you to adjust the length of the word in which soft hyphens will be placed.
- Added a setting that allows <p> & nbsp; </ p> to be considered a correct line feed.
ERRORS- Fixed operation of the remove tags button.
- Fixed rule removing spaces before punctuation.
- The rule attaching alliances to the words following them has been fixed.
- Fixed rule for typing phone numbers.
- Fixed the rule with the binding of particles, b , eh, li, g, ka.
- Fixed a processing rule, either, or something. (“I want a dress somehow , or like this” was typed incorrectly).
At first glance, 
not so much , but 
I found it worthy of a separate version.
Some functions, though stated, 
were not implemented by me. 
In particular, I still have not separated the text verification 
and typography for different buttons. 
Did not make a lot of settings 
and update the dictionary.
All this is to 
come , 
but first of all 
I plan to change the external "interface" of the project. Make it more fresh, modern, 
web-two-bit if you like.
What else 
in the near future:
- Release of the Air version .
- Implementing plugins for CMS editors and blogs .
- English localization.
That's 
all . Welcome!
PS Today, the Typographer is used by more than 1000 regular users. 
Since its launch, 
it has helped to fix almost half a million texts.
PPS Sorry for the fact that the special characters are written incorrectly, the Habro-parser cuts.